Alex Baumeier
About Alex Baumeier
Alex Baumeier is a Senior Marketing Manager with extensive experience in marketing and sales across various industries. He has held positions at notable companies such as Anheuser-Busch, Procter & Gamble, and Capstone Event Group, and he holds a BA in Advertising from the University of North Carolina at Chapel Hill.

Previous Experience at Anheuser-Busch
Prior to joining Poppi, Alex Baumeier worked at Anheuser-Busch in various roles. He served as the Senior Manager of Sports Marketing & Partnerships from 2023 to 2024, where he focused on enhancing the brand's presence in the sports sector. He also held the position of Regional Experiential Manager from 2022 to 2023, and worked as a Social Listening Analyst from 2021 to 2022, providing insights into consumer behavior and brand perception.
Education and Expertise
Alex Baumeier earned a Bachelor of Arts in Advertising from the University of North Carolina at Chapel Hill, where he studied from 2016 to 2020. He also completed a Minor in Entrepreneurship during his studies. This educational background provides him with a solid foundation in marketing principles and business strategies.
Early Career and Internships
Before establishing his career in marketing, Alex Baumeier gained valuable experience through various internships. He worked as a Sales Intern at Altria and Procter & Gamble in 2018 and 2019, respectively. Additionally, he served as a Sales & Marketing Intern at Capstone Event Group from 2018 to 2019. These roles contributed to his understanding of sales and marketing dynamics.
